How they compare

Georgia currently reports 1,086 m3 against 1,068 m3 in Tunisia, a difference of 18 m3.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 10 shared years of data; in 2006 it was Tunisia ahead.

Georgia ranks 35th and Tunisia ranks 37th of 68 countries.

Georgia has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
